A bit about my process. I don't use Layout, all these sheets were formatted in Photoshop after exporting JPG files from SketchUp. Also, I don't typically use SketchUp for presentation or marketing graphics. I use it primarily as a schematic design and design development tool and often export DWG files back to AutoCad for further development into the production of construction drawings. The images I posted were an outgrowth of this process, thus the simple, basic SketchUp rendering techniques you see.
